Status Alert
White (knee) returned to practice Friday, the Atlanta Journal-Constitution reports. "I anticipate (him) being ready to go on Sunday afternoon," coach Mike Smith said. (Nov 6)

Blog | November 02, 2009Ryan's third INT the costliest as Saints fend off furious rally to go to 7-0
Associated PressDrew Brees had 308 yards passing, Pierre Thomas scored two touchdowns and Jabari Greer returned an interception for a score to help the Saints improve to 7-0 with a 35-27 victory over the Atlanta Falcons on Monday night.
